Autodesk MapGuide Author Key Features
Accurate display of authored maps
Map and resource security control
Style display by scale
Thematic map settings and symbology
Complete layer setup and definition, including support for layer groups
Multiple Document Interface (MDI) support
Global property settings, including projection information and map
extents
Interactive Map Explorer for creating and updating maps, drawings,
designs, and schematics
Full zoom/unzoom/pan functionality, including zooming to specific fea-
tures
Multiple feature selection by list/radius/polygon
Map bookmarking
Point feature posting
Intelligent map caching
Support for multi-server connection
Buffer zone creation
Arbitrary
X,Y
coordinate system support for CAD designs, drawings, or
schematics
Support for both vector and raster data types, overlaid, georeferenced, or
not georeferenced
Ability to link map features to web applications
Control over map width/scale
Ability to measure distances between indicated points on a map
Ability to copy to Windows Clipboard
Print capability
